Here is the latest analysis on my wife's WRX. We ran the oil out to 6,800 miles with ZERO added oil. This is all city/highway, no autox and usually a pretty light foot (gas prices and all).

It compares to the previous analysis with Royal Purple w/Napa Gold filter. We had a crack in the air box, which caused the high silicon, and that was replaced. This sample was with a Pureone filter. Thoughts? I will be sticking to the Redline.
